Originally published in single magazine form as The wicked + the divine #1-5.
Matthew Wilson, colorist ; Nathan Fairbairn, guest colourist #4, pp. 1-2 ; Clayton Cowles, letterer ;
Every ninety years, twelve gods return as young people. They are loved. They are hated. In two years, they are all dead. It's happening now. It's happening again.

My excitement after reading this was neverending!
This comic blends popular culture and mythology in a way that I've never seen before. It tells the story of twelve normal teenagers who suddenly manifest the power and divinity of gods from mythologies all over the world. Their incarnations are not antiquated - they manifest as modern constructs. For example, Dionysis is a rave DJ, Ares a sports superstar, and the Morrigan is a goth icon. Even though they're gods, they are still teenagers - and make the same stupid decisions and are ruled by the same hormones. It's a riotously fun romp through all aspects of human nature.
Some themes touched on are teenage disillusionment, loneliness, cultural appropriation, gender studies, celebrity worship, the perils of fame and the difficulties of growing up.
